How do I submit a trade-in request?Updated a year ago

Explanation of our trade-in tool

Our trade-in algorithm immediately estimates the value of a brand on the second-hand market. As time passes, the residual value of a brand changes. The value of a bicycle is now determined based on five criteria: brand, recommended retail price, type of bicycle, year of manufacturing and mileage.

  • Bicycle Brand: We collaborate with over 200 brands.
  • New price: Retail Price of the bicycle corresponding to year (accessories are NOT taken into account unless dual batteries or range extenders)
  • Date of purchase: Year Model of Manufacturing (not sales)
  • Miles: number of miles displayed on the odometer when you receive the bicycle
  • Proposed price: Acquisition price is all-inclusive (incl. taxes) meaning is the total value we will recognize and pay for the bicycle
  • Condition Assumptions:
    • The motor and battery power on.
    • You can change and switch engine modes.
    • No cracks in the frame or fork.
    • Complete set (at least one key, charger included).
  • Bicycle Origin: Indicate from whom you are acquiring the bicycle to ensure accurate accounting
  • Important:  Information to share internally (e.g., Mrs. Jacksons' bicycle)

NB! Each trade-in request remains valid for a maximum of 2 weeks from the date of submission. If you have not scheduled the pick-up within this period, the trade-in request, including the stated price, will be forfeited. After 2 weeks you will have to submit a new trade-in request.
